A recent study has revealed that Porsche is most appealing car brand and it has topped the charts for the ninth straight year.
The Automotive Performance, Execution and Layout (APEAL) study looks at how pleasing a new car is to own and drive in the first 90 days of ownership, the Sydney Morning Herald reports.
According to the report, Porsche has topped the annual JD Power study into ownership gratification.
Porsche ranked first with a score of 884, well ahead of Audi, BMW, Land Rover and Toyota-owned luxury brand Lexus.
The Porsche Cayenne was the pick of the mid-size premium SUV segment, the report added.
